Personalised Gifts
Personalised gifts add a special touch to Christmas presents. Whether it’s a custom-made piece of jewellery with the recipient’s initials or a monogrammed leather notebook, personalised gifts show that you’ve put thought and effort into selecting something truly unique.
Artistic Creations
Art has the power to evoke emotions and create lasting memories. Consider gifting a piece of artwork from a local artist or an art print that resonates with the recipient’s taste. From vibrant abstract paintings to serene landscape photography, artistic creations make for timeless and meaningful gifts.
Experiential Gifts
Instead of physical items, why not gift experiences that create lasting memories? Treat your loved one to a cooking class, spa day, concert tickets, or a weekend getaway. Experiential gifts offer the opportunity to create new experiences together and strengthen your bond.
Sustainable Gifts
In today’s environmentally conscious world, sustainable gifts are gaining popularity. Consider eco-friendly products such as reusable water bottles, organic skincare sets, or handmade items crafted from sustainable materials. These gifts not only show your care for the planet but also promote sustainable living.
The Gift of Giving Back
This Christmas, consider giving back to those in need on behalf of your loved ones. Donate to a charity in their name, volunteer at a local shelter together, or support small businesses that give back to their communities. The gift of giving back spreads joy not only to the recipient but also to those in need.

1. Expense
The expense of Christmas gifts can often present a significant challenge, particularly when the pressure to purchase costly presents for all loved ones arises. This financial strain can lead to stress and anxiety as individuals try to balance their desire to show appreciation with their budgetary constraints. The expectation of extravagant gifts may overshadow the true spirit of giving, turning a joyous occasion into a source of financial burden for many during the festive season.
2. Stress
During the festive season, the con of Christmas gifts lies in the stress it can bring. The expectation to discover the ideal present for every individual on your list often results in heightened pressure and anxiety. This quest for perfection can overshadow the joy of giving and receiving gifts, turning what should be a joyful time into a source of worry and tension. It is essential to remember that the sentiment behind a gift holds more value than its monetary worth, and alleviating this pressure can help refocus on the true spirit of Christmas.
3. Materialism
An inherent con of Christmas gifts is the risk of materialism overshadowing the true essence of the festive season. When there is an excessive emphasis on material gifts, the core values of Christmas, such as love, kindness, and togetherness, can often be overlooked. The commercialisation of Christmas may lead individuals to equate the holiday’s significance with the value of presents exchanged, rather than cherishing meaningful connections and shared experiences with loved ones. It is essential to strike a balance between gift-giving and embracing the genuine spirit of Christmas that transcends material possessions.
4. Environmental Impact
The environmental impact of Christmas gifts is a significant concern, with many presents being wrapped in excessive packaging that is often not eco-friendly. This overuse of materials not only contributes to environmental waste but also adds to the growing issue of plastic pollution. As we celebrate the season of giving, it is important to consider the sustainability of our gift choices and opt for more environmentally friendly alternatives to help reduce our carbon footprint and protect the planet for future generations.
5. Expectations
One significant drawback of Christmas gift-giving is the impact it can have on expectations. The act of giving gifts during the festive season can inadvertently create a sense of obligation for reciprocation. This expectation may overshadow the true essence of joy in giving, turning a heartfelt gesture into a transactional exchange. When gifts come with strings attached, the genuine spirit of generosity and thoughtfulness can be overshadowed by feelings of duty and pressure, detracting from the joy that should accompany the act of giving.
6. Clutter
One significant downside of Christmas gifts is the issue of clutter. When individuals receive numerous gifts during the festive season, it can result in a build-up of unnecessary items in their homes. This clutter can be particularly problematic if the gifts lack practicality or sentimental value, leading to a space filled with objects that serve no purpose other than taking up room. Over time, this accumulation of unneeded possessions can contribute to a sense of disorganisation and overwhelm, detracting from the joy that gift-giving is intended to bring.
